Unleashing Innovation: The Future of Autonomous Vehicles

In recent years, urban landscapes have witnessed a significant transformation, with self-driving cars becoming an increasingly familiar sight in cities like San Francisco and Phoenix. As technology has advanced, these autonomous vehicles have moved from the realm of science fiction into practical applications on our streets, stirring both enthusiasm and unease among the populace. The promises that accompany this innovation are staggering: reduced traffic accidents, decreased congestion, and improved mobility for those unable to drive. Yet, despite these optimistic projections, the overwhelming complexity of integrating self-driving cars into existing systems and societal norms must not be overlooked.

Regulatory Challenges and Safety Considerations

Safety regulations remain one of the most contentious points of discussion surrounding self-driving cars. Regulatory bodies are caught in a perpetual balancing act between fostering innovation and ensuring public safety. In their race to deploy autonomous vehicles, tech companies are routinely challenged with stringent safety protocols that must be adhered to before wide-scale implementation can occur. Companies are continually scrutinized regarding how they collect and utilize data from their vehicles, particularly when this data might impact the safety of passengers and pedestrians alike.

Arian Marshall from WIRED highlights how the implementation of safety measures and standards can either hinder or expedite the introduction of such technology. As it stands, we are in a crucial moment where regulatory frameworks are being shaped, and the rules established now will echo into the future of transportation.

Robotaxis: Convenience or Risk?

As the idea of robotaxis permeates public consciousness, numerous questions arise concerning their reliability and safety. The promise of hopping into a vehicle without the attention of a human driver is appealing, particularly for urban dwellers. However, the prospect of a driverless vehicle navigating the complexities of city streets—where human unpredictability is the norm—raises concerns among potential users.

Advocates frequently highlight a future where robotaxis offer substantial benefits, such as reducing the need for personal car ownership and providing mobility options for the elderly and disabled. On the flip side, skeptics argue that reliance on machines could inevitably lead to unforeseen risks, including privacy concerns from constant data collection and a lack of accountability in the event of accidents. The duality of convenience versus risk is a recurring motif that encapsulates the transition into a future filled with automated companions.

Imagining a Futuristic Landscape

When envisioning a future dominated by driverless cars, several factors must be contemplated. Will our streets transform into a seamless network of autonomous vehicles in constant communication, or will human-driven cars continue to coexist, leading to chaos and conflict? It’s crucial to ponder how cities will adapt infrastructure to accommodate this new breed of transportation. Will designated lanes be created, or will traffic signals undergo a revolution to better serve an environment populated with self-driving technology?

Moreover, the societal implications of widespread autonomous vehicle adoption cannot be ignored. What happens to the millions of individuals whose livelihoods depend on driving? The workforce for ridesharing services, taxi drivers, and even delivery truck operators may face a seismic shift, demand for new skills, and an urgent need to adapt to an evolving job market.
